Automatically starting firefox is up to your desktop environment.  Save
your session in Gnome or KDE, and that should happen for you.  Or run it
on login.

As for saving the open things as they were when you last had Firefox
running, try the SessionSaver extension:

    https://addons.update.mozilla.org/extensions/moreinfo.php?id=436

While I haven't played with it myself, I believe that it is quite stble
and works nicely.  it should save the current tabs, etc, as you have
them running, even if you manage to crash Firefox.

There are other extensions that sort of do this too, but many of them
try to do too much, and so can cause other "issues".
